Indigenous-led Watershed Restoration in the Upper Pitt Watershed
This project advances ecosystem restoration and support the recovery
of Pacific salmon populations in the Lower Fraser Watershed by undertaking watershed restoration and advancing the community's vision for a future sustainable economy. Specifically, this project includes restoration work in key salmon spawning habitat, and helps advance Katzie's implementation of the 'Katzie Upper Pitt River Watershed Strategic Plan'. The plan will guide decisions regarding the future of the fishery and the creation of a new economy based on the holistic management of ecosystems and resources.
